Not sure about attaching the filter and then the hood. Will confirm when I get home but think it's unlikely given lens hood mounts via a dedicated mount rather than via the filter thread

With regards to settings, key is to set auto compensation dial to -.3 or even -.5 EV since meter tends to over-expose slightly. Like many others I find shooting with dynamic range set to normal or lowest setting and film setting to standard works well for my taste. Watch out for subjects with highly saturated reds ( flowers etc) as detail tends together blown out (though easily recovered in post). Have fun. It's a great camera to shoot with.
 
Just confirmed that you may be able to use a 52mm after you attach the lens hood, but it looks like it will be a tight fit. You may have a hard time screwing in the filter to the lens thread because there is very little clearance between the filter and the hood. Don't know for sure since i do not have a 52mm filter.
